Diskuze: Převod relačních dat do objektového jazyku
V předchozím kvízu, Test znalostí C# .NET online, jsme si ověřili nabyté zkušenosti z kurzu.
Člen
Zobrazeno 5 zpráv z 5.
//= Settings::TRACKING_CODE_B ?> //= Settings::TRACKING_CODE ?>
V předchozím kvízu, Test znalostí C# .NET online, jsme si ověřili nabyté zkušenosti z kurzu.
Ak mas databazu podla ktorej vytvaras dbo objekty pouzi entity framework model first, ten ti na zaklade databazy vygeneruje edml diagram a dbo objekty zo vsetkymi relaciami ktore mas vo svojej databaze
Nemám úplně dobrou představu na základě čeho a podle jakých pravidel ty struktury vytváří, ale celkově je to dost zmatené a je těžké se v tom vyznat.
Ideální je, dělat to obráceně. Vytvořit třídy a z nich pak tabulky (CodeFirst)...
Používám transaction script takže code frist u mně moc fungovat nebude. Jsou nějaké pravidla pro skládání objektů na základě cizích klíčů? Prošel jsem vzory co znám ale jasnější mi to není.
Pokud mám třídu Faktura, který má zachovat vazbu 1:N ke třídě PolozkaFaktury tak by objekt Faktura mohl obsahovat List<PolozkaFaktury> s tím, že tahat všechny data do té kolekce budu málokdy. Má objekt PolozkaFaktury obsahovat objekt Faktura? A pokud ano dá se vyhýbat zacyklení jinak než dávat si pozor ? (zacyklení = Načtu objekt faktura, všechny položky té faktury a položka faktury obsahuje zase objekt faktura, který zase načtu celý a tak pořád dokola).
Nemáte odkaz na nějaký hezký článek o tom jak převést db do objetků bez použití ORM nástrojů? Díky
Zobrazeno 5 zpráv z 5.